Transform your classroom into a solar learning lab with We Care Solar’s Solar Suitcase Learning Kit. In this interactive session, educators will explore how the Solar Suitcase brings clean energy concepts to life through hands-on, project-based learning. Designed for middle and high school classrooms, the kit allows students to assemble, test, and troubleshoot a fully functioning, portable solar energy system while building foundational knowledge in renewable energy, electrical circuits, and systems thinking. Participants will experience a live demonstration of the Solar Suitcase Learning Kit, explore curriculum connections aligned to STEM and CTE pathways, and learn practical strategies for classroom implementation. The session will also highlight how solar learning supports career awareness by introducing students to clean energy careers, technical skills, and real-world applications. Attendees will leave with free instructional resources, opportunities to apply for the kits, and inspiration to empower students through engaging, hands-on solar learning experiences across diverse classrooms and evolving career-connected learning environments.
